Benefits of Lithium Batteries

High Energy Density: Lithium batteries are renowned for their ability to store a significant amount of energy in a small space. This property makes them ideal for portable devices, electric vehicles, and energy storage systems. High energy density ensures that devices can operate for extended periods without needing to recharge.

Long Cycle Life: Lithium batteries can undergo numerous charging and discharging cycles without experiencing a significant decline in performance. This durability makes them suitable for applications where frequent charging is common, such as smartphones, laptops, and electric vehicles.

Low Self-Discharge: Unlike many battery types, lithium batteries retain their charge even when not in use. This feature is particularly advantageous for consumer electronics that are often left uncharged for long periods.

Fast Charging: Lithium batteries can be charged quickly, reducing the time required for power restoration. This fast charging capability enhances user experience, especially for applications with high-power demands.

Wide Temperature Range: Lithium batteries can function effectively in a wide range of temperatures, making them suitable for use in various climates. This versatility is particularly important in applications like electric vehicles, which may operate in extreme weather conditions.

Compact and Lightweight: The small size and light weight of lithium batteries make them ideal for portable devices. This is a critical factor in applications where space and weight are limited, such as in consumer electronics and cordless tools.

Common Uses of Lithium Batteries

Consumer Electronics: Lithium batteries are extensively used in consumer electronics such as smartphones, laptops, and digital cameras. These devices require a high energy density to operate efficiently, and lithium batteries provide the necessary power density.

Electric Vehicles: Lithium battery packs are integral to the functionality of electric vehicles. They power the vehicle and enable long-distance travel without frequent charging stops. Lithium's high energy density makes it an ideal choice for electric vehicles.

Renewable Energy Storage: Lithium batteries store energy from solar and wind power, ensuring a reliable and steady supply of electricity. This application is crucial for grid management and meeting peak energy demands during periods of low renewable energy generation.

Medical Devices: Lithium batteries are widely used in medical devices such as pacemakers and defibrillators. Their high reliability and long cycle life make them suitable for devices that require uninterrupted power operation.

Aerospace: Lithium batteries are used in aircraft and spacecraft due to their high energy density and ability to function in a wide range of temperatures. Their compact size and lightweight make them ideal for space and air travel.

Power Tools: Lithium batteries power cordless drills, saws, and other power tools. Their fast charging and compact size make them convenient for use in handheld tools.

Backup Power: Lithium batteries are used in uninterrupted power supplies to ensure that critical systems remain operational during power outages.

Grid Storage: Lithium batteries play a vital role in stabilizing electrical grids by storing excess energy during peak production times and releasing it during periods of high demand.

Electric Bicycles: Lithium batteries extend the range of electric bicycles, providing users with longer travel distances without the need for frequent charging.

Marine and RVs: Lithium batteries power boats and recreational vehicles, offering their users the convenience of a reliable power source while ensuring portability and durability.
